* fix: don't constrain middlewares' context-keys to strings
`context` recommends using "unexported type" as context keys to avoid
collisions https://pkg.go.dev/github.com/gofiber/fiber/v2#Ctx.Locals.
The official go blog also recommends this https://go.dev/blog/context.
`fiber.Ctx.Locals(key any, value any)` correctly allows consumers to
use unexported types or e.g. strings.
But some fiber middlewares constrain their context-keys to `string` in
their "default config structs", making it impossible to use unexported
types.
This PR removes the `string` _constraint_ from all middlewares, allowing
to now use unexported types as per the official guidelines. However
the default value is still a string, so it's not a breaking change, and
anyone still using strings as context keys is not affected.
